    Key Features

    Key FeaturesNXDN Digital Air Interface
    AMBE+2 Vocoder for Natural Sounding Digital Voice
    Operates in NXDN Digital Conventional and FM Analogue modes, even on the same channel. Autosenses Received Mode (Digital or Analogue)
    Digital Conventional and Digital Trunking Modes
    Multi-Site Digital Trunking, up to 60000 GIDs and 60000 UIDs per Network
    Multi-Site IP Network Compatible
    True 6.25 kHz channel spacing operation
    Includes Radio-To-Radio Mode (no repeater needed)
    IP54/55 and MIL-STD 810C/D/E/F/G Certification

    Technical Specifications

    Technical SpecificationsFrequency Range136 - 174 MHz
    Number of Channels260
    Number of Zones128
    Talk GroupsYes
    Channel Frequency Spread38 MHz
    Channel Spacing - Analogue - Wide/Mid/Narrow25 kHz/20 kHz/12.5 kHz
    Channel Spacing - Digital - Wide/Narrow12.5 kHz/6.25 kHz
    Antenna Impedance - 50 OhmYes
    Battery Life5-5-90
    with KNB-57L: approx 11.5 hours
    with KNB-56N: approx 8.5 hours
    with KNB-55L: approx 8.5 hours
    Frequency Stability± 2 ppm (-30 °C to + 60 °C)
    Operating Temperature Range-30 °C to + 60 °C
    Operating Voltage7.5 V DC ± 20%
    DimensionsWith KNB-57L:
    56 x 110.5 x 39.5 mm
    With KNB-56N:
    56 x 110.5 x 43.2 mm
    With KNB-55L:
    56 x 110.5 x 37.5 mm

    - Projections not included -
    Weight (net)With KNB-57L: 330 g
    With KNB-56N: 405 g
    With KNB-55L: 305 g

    Receiver Specifications

    Receiver SpecificationsAdjacent Channel Selectivity (Analogue)76 dB at 25 kHz
    74 dB at 20 kHz
    68 dB at 12.5 kHz
    Audio Output500 mW with less than 3% distortion. 8 Ohms Impedance
    Intermodulation (Analogue)65 dB
    Sensitivity (Analogue) - EIA 12 dB SINAD0.28 µV at 25 kHz
    0.28 µV at 20 kHz
    0.32 µV at 12.5 kHz
    Sensitivity (Analogue) - EN 20 dB SINAD-3 dB µV at 25 kHz
    -3 dB µV at 20 kHz
    -1 dB µV at 12.5 kHz
    Sensitivity (Digital)3% BER:
    0.32 µV at 12.5 kHz
    0.25 µV at 6.25 kHz
    1% BER:
    -1 dB µV at 12.5 kHz
    -4 dB µV at 6.25 kHz
    Spurious Reponse Rejection (Analogue)75 dB

    Transmitter Specifications

    Transmitter SpecificationsRF Power Output (High/Low)5 W / 1 W
    FM Noise (EIA)Analogue:
    45 dB at 25 kHz
    45 dB at 20 kHz
    40 dB at 12.5 kHz
    Microphone Impedance1800 Ohm
    Modulation DistortionLess than 3%
    Modulation LimitingAnalogue:
    ± 5.0 kHz at 25 kHz
    ± 4.0 kHz at 20 kHz
    ± 2.5 kHz at 12.5 kHz
    Spurious Emission (EN)-36 dBm ≤ 1 GHz
    -30 dBm > 1 GHz
